Emergency Crews Respond to Hazardous Materials Incident in Harrison

The incident took place at Kaplan Industries on Kilby Road.

(Harrison, Oh.) – At approximately 9:52 a.m., emergency crews were dispatched to Kaplan Industries on Kilby Road for a reported hazardous materials incident.

According to Whitewater Township Fire/EMS, the incident involved an approximately 80-pound compressed gas cylinder venting an unknown substance.

Upon arrival, crews identified an unidentified gas cylinder labeled “Precision Poisons Gas” that was actively leaking from a damaged valve while positioned on its side.

Due to the unknown nature of the product and out of an abundance of caution for public health and safety, individuals within a 500-foot radius of the incident were advised to shelter in place.

During the incident, a visible plume was identified venting into the air, however, the plume did not extend beyond the perimeter of the business property.

Cincinnati Fire Department Hazardous Materials Unit was requested to assist. Responders were able to safely upright the cylinder and secure the leak by placing a protective cap on the damaged valve.

The incident was brought under control without injury to emergency responders or the public. Shelter in place advisories were lifted once the scene was determined to be safe.

Facility management has assumed responsibility for the cylinder and will coordinate the proper disposal process.
